Qwest Communications International said Dec. 21 that it has secured a new $1.04 billion revolving credit agreement.The new agreement will expire Sept. 30, 2013. It replaces an existing revolving credit agreement that was to expire Oct. 21.The phone company said that it has not yet drawn on the agreement, and if it does it will ...
